Inside Marie Claire’s July 2011 Issue: Elle Fanning

[In this photo, dress by Lanvin; belt by Meredith Wendell; bracelet by Emporio Armani; and tulle by Manny's Milinery Supply Co.]

   With ten pages all to herself in Marie Claire’s upcoming 2011 July Issue, Dakota Fanning’s little sister, Elle Fanning, lets her passion for clothes speak out. In her interview, Elle is very frank, telling Marie Claire that “the best part of [her] day is picking out [her] outfit”. And even though she is only thirteen, this young star shows that she definitely knows what to pick. For her photo shoot, Elle wears clothes in pastel shades, with plenty of shimmer, glitter, and texture. Apart from a bracelet or two in a couple of the photographs, Elle’s only other accessories are gloves, fishnet tights, tulle and chunky heels – all making the vintage inspiration behind photographs of her very clear.

                            [In this photo, dress by Prada; and gloves by LaCrasia Gloves]

   And to convince us that she knows her vintage, Elle Fanning draws on French model, actress and singer, Brigitte Bardot for inspiration. If you are surprised, don’t be. In her interview, Elle admits that she “knows all of the models”. And considering that Brigitte Bardot was the biggest name in film and fashion of the fifties-sixties, it was almost natural that Elle Fanning would channel her for Marie Claire’s pictorial to show her love for the era.
